Work as Prosecutor or Public Defender for 3 Years = $60k in Student Loan Repayment

At least that is what the House of Representatives want. The House on Tuesday passed the Justice Prosecutors and Defenders Act of 2007 (H.R. 916), which would:

  • Establish a program of student loan repayment for borrowers who agree to remain employed, for at least three years, as State or local criminal prosecutors or as State, local or Federal public defenders in criminal cases
  • Allow eligible attorneys to receive student loan debt repayments of up to $10,000 per year, with a maximum aggregate over time of $60,000
